Central Highlands needs more preferential policies to attract investment

VGP – PM Nguyen Tan Dung has tasked the Ministry of Planning and Investment to perfect preferential mechanisms and policies to boost investments and ensure national defense and security in the Central Highlands region.

PM Nguyen Tan Dung (R) at the 2nd Conference on Investment Promotion for the Central Highlands region, Gia Lai, April 12 - Photo: VGP

The Government chief made the request at the 2nd Conference on Investment Promotion for the Central Highlands region held in Gia Lai province on April 12.

He also urged localities in the region to step up mobilization of domestic and foreign resources to improve infrastructure system, especially roads connecting to seaports, airports, coastal urban and adjacent areas.

The region needs to develop a high-quality workforce, take proper measures to encourage technological application, renovation and transfer, and accelerate administrative reform to create a favorable business environment.

Bo Y and Le Thanh Economic Zones will be further invested to become a driving force for the region’s socio-economic development.

PM Dung pointed out that investment attraction into the Central Highlands must be combined with the guarantee of national defense and security as well as social order and safety of the region.

During this conference, commercial banks and enterprises signed 28 credit contracts to finance VND 23,899 billion for production of coffee, rubber and power generation.

Leaders of the regional provinces also handed over investment certificates to 13 businesses with total investment of over VND 16 trillion./.
